Part 1: YouTube Banner Dimensions You Should Know
YouTube banner dimensions varied on different platforms, so you need to make the YouTube banner look great on desktop, tablet, and phone. According to Google , the recommended dimension is 2560 x 1440 px as the YouTube banner will be cropped if its size is too large. Minimum dimension is 2048 x 1152 px for uploading. The maximum width is 2560 x 423 px. The largest file size is 6MB. You can also add links to your own social media on YouTube banner, so it is a great place to recommend your other social media.

Step 1: Choose your template and layout
Canva is an online tool to make YouTube banner, so first you need to open it up . You are asked to log in.
After you’ve signed up for Canva you will see a variety of different templates. Scroll through them until you find YouTube Channel Art under Social Media & Email Headers.
This template will be the right size for a YouTube banner, but it will not show you the ‘safe zones’. Your banner will show up differently depending on the screen a viewer is watching on. Click here to download YouTube’s official template, which displays safe zones. You will be able to use it as a reference.
And Canva also provides you with sample layouts that you can build off of. They will include stock photos and text. Most are free, but some might cost a dollar.
If the one you happen to like isn’t free, don’t worry. It’s actually just the specific stock images being used in the example that cost money, and you’re probably planning on replacing those anyways.
Step 2: Import your image
Canva provides a selection of stock images you can use for free. You can find them by clicking on Elements in the menu on the far left, and then clicking on Free Photos.
If you’d rather use your own images, click on Upload at the bottom of that same menu on the left. You’ll have the option of uploading images from your computer or importing them from Facebook.
After you have found the image you want to use or loaded it into Canva, click on it and it will appear in your layout.
Step 3: Add text to YouTube banner
You can add various text after it is imported. There are lots of text templates in Canva, so just pick the one you like. You can also change text color and transparency to make it look great. Now to place it in the right position.
Step 4: Edit other elements
The layout you chose might include things like borders or backgrounds behind the text. You can change the colors of any of these just by clicking on them, then clicking on the color swatch in the top left corner of your design area.
Step 5: Download YouTube banner
Once you finish the editing, there is a download button in the top right corner of your screen. Click on it when you are finished to save your new channel art to your computer. It supports JPEG, PNG, and PDF. Now upload it to YouTube. So simple. Isn’t it?

YouTube Ads
The video ads on the platform aren’t lucrative and can be used to supplement your income in the form of AdSense earnings. An actual advertiser pays 0.18 per ad view on average (as shown above). That means 1000 ad views equals $18 and $3-$5 per 1000 views.
Brand Sponsorships
Brands can sponsor your videos to reach their target audience. YouTube videos are a big part of our lives, and brands are becoming increasingly aware of how useful these videos can be. To be eligible for sponsorship, your channel must be of 5000 subscribers.
Affiliate Marketing
YouTubers help brands increase sales by encouraging their viewers to shop at the company’s store or visit its specific product pages. They then earn a commission (30%-35%) on products that people buy after clicking an affiliate link.
Crowdfunding
Today many people use crowdfunding websites to raise money for personal, channel-related projects. Most YouTubers are doing it to generate steady cash flow. Some of them use this source to fund their YouTube videos so that it increases quality and engagement.
Merchandise Shelf
Your merchandise represents and feeds your audience’s connection with you. Your product is your business, so you’re first and foremost an entrepreneur. Then design your YouTube marketing strategy to sell your merchandise and generate income.
Channel Membership
YouTube has a plan that allows you to charge your subscribers for membership on your YouTube channel. Members get access to exclusive live chats, badges, emojis, etc. Subscribers must give a set amount every month to a channel that makes a steady monthly income for YouTubers.

Part 3: Estimated your YouTube earning by YouTube revenue reports
To better understand the best strategies and tactics to optimize your video content, use YouTube analytic reports to help you get a clearer understanding of how your YouTube channel performs. To check your revenue report:
Step1 Login to your YouTube Studio
Step2 In the left menu, select Analytics.
Step3 From the top menu, select Revenue.
RPM
The RPM is calculated based on how much traffic you’re getting from YouTube compared to all your other sources combined. RPM is calculated as total revenue divided by total views times 1000.
Playback-based CPM
Your CPM (Cost Per Thousand) report tells you how much each ad was worth in terms of the percentage of each play a video was spent. The playback-based CPM report shows your estimated average gross revenue per 1000 playbacks where one or more ads are shown.
Monthly estimated revenue
This is a simple report showing the statistics of your video earnings over the last 6 months. It can fluctuate by invalid traffic, content disputes and ad campaign types.
Revenue sources
You must use this report to see your estimated revenue from each revenue source if you have different revenue sources.
Transaction revenue
The transactions reports show you how much your members and fans have spent in transactions. It shows estimated earnings from channel memberships and merch.
Top-earning videos
This top-earning videos report will show you the most profitable videos and their estimated revenue.
Ad type
If you use different types of Ads for your videos, this report will help you find the percentage of your Ads revenue from each ad type.
